Warning Signs You Need Trim & Baseboard Replacement After Water Damage
Ignoring water damage can lead to costly repairs, health hazards, and even structural issues down the line. That’s why it’s crucial to catch these warning signs early. Don’t wait until it’s too late, spot these signs and act fast.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ice persistent musty smells in your home, it’s time to investigate further.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can lead to bigger problems.
Warped or Discolored Trim and Baseboards
Water damage can cause your trim and baseboards to warp or discolor. If you notice any changes in the color or shape of these areas, it’s time to call in the pros. Don’t wait until the damage is irreversible.
Cracks in the Walls or Ceilings
Cracks in your wal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. If you notice any cracks, it’s essential to investigate further.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can lead to costly repairs.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your walls, ceilings, or floors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any of these warning signs, it’s time to call in the pros. Don’t wait until the damage is irreversible.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or moisture issues. If you notice any peeling or bubbling, it’s time to investigate further.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can lead to bigger problems.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Mold or mildew growth can be a sign of water damage or poor ventilation. If you notice any signs of mold or mildew, it’s essential to address the issue immediately. Don’t wait until it spreads, call us today.
Trim & Baseboard Replacement After Water Damage v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water damage, affecting only a few square feet | Yes | No | DIY is usually enough for small, isolated water damage jobs. |
| Water damage to multiple rooms or extensive areas | No | Yes | Professional help is needed for larger water damage jobs to ensure a thorough and safe restoration. |
| You’re unsure about the extent of the damage | No | Yes | A professional assessment is crucial in determining the full extent of the damage and creating a comprehensive plan for restoration. |
| You’re dealing with black water or sewage | No | Yes | Black water or sewage contamination needs specialized equipment and training to safely and effectively clean and disinfect the affected area. |
| You’re not comfortable with DIY projects or don’t have the necessary skills | No | Yes | Trim and baseboard replacement needs specialized skills and equipment, leave it to the pros to ensure a professional finish. |
| You want a warranty or satisfaction guarantee | No | Yes | Professional contractors offer warranties and satisfaction guarantees, providing you with peace of mind and protection for your investment. |
